Pellet Bucket Roundup: Best Options for Your Operation
Selecting the right pellet delivery system for your farm is a important decision impacting productivity and overall cost. There's a broad range of options available, each with its own strengths and limitations. From simple, manually-operated containers for smaller operations to sophisticated, self-propelled systems for high-volume output, understanding your specific needs is paramount. Consider factors like pellet grade, desired size, terrain obstacles, and financial constraints. A smaller spread might only require a basic bucket, while a large-scale handling facility would benefit from an automated system. Auger Motor Power: Keepin' the Flow
Ensuring consistent material transport in a system relies heavily on the drive of your auger motor. These often-overlooked parts are the workhorses behind so many industries, from horticultural applications like grain processing check here to manufacturing conveying of powders and granules. A powerful auger motor doesn’t just rotate; it provides the torque needed to overcome friction and maintain ideal flow rates, even when dealing with difficult materials. Regularly examining the motor's shape and ensuring adequate oiling are crucial steps in preventing costly downtime and maximizing complete efficiency.
Pellet Buckets: Durable Storage Solutions
When it comes to efficiently managing wood fuel, durable bio buckets are an essential asset for homeowners and professionals equally. These robust containers are designed to withstand the demands of storing and transporting firewood, preventing spills and minimizing mess. Unlike flimsy alternatives, quality pellet buckets typically feature reinforced rims and heavy-duty construction, ensuring they can withstand repeated use without cracking or breaking. A well-chosen bucket not only protects your product but also contributes to a safer and more organized workspace or storage area. Consider factors like capacity and material when selecting the best pellet bucket to suit your specific demands. Many options are available with secure lids, further protecting your valuable fuel source from moisture and pests. For those requiring large quantities, stackable designs offer an even more efficient storage option.

Robust Auger Motors for Pellet Distribution Systems
Ensuring a consistent supply of pellets to your livestock or poultry is paramount for optimal growth and productivity. At the heart of many pellet distribution systems lies the auger motor – and selecting the right one is crucial. Standard motors often struggle with the rigorous conditions of continuous operation, the abrasive nature of pellets, and the potential for overloading.
